A construction worker was injured when a portion of the roof of the corridor in front of Thoothukudi Government Medical College Hospital’s (TKMCH) gastroenterology ward collapsed on Thursday afternoon.
Sources in the TKMCH said the mishap occurred when renovation of this 35-year-old building was going on after the patients were shifted to some other area.
“As the roof measuring about 10 feet into 12 feet came down crashing, a construction worker involved in the renovation suffered injuries. He was immediately rushed to the emergency ward and his condition is stable,” the sources said.
Doctors of the TKMCH complain that the Public Works Department, which had been entrusted with the duty of maintaining government buildings and the hospitals, was exhibiting “indifferent attitude” in maintaining or repairing the TKMCH despite repeated appeals and reminders.
“The drainage channels within the campus of TKMCH are now half-filled with silt. We sent reminders to desilt the sewage channels within TKMCH campus before the start of northeast monsoon. No action has been taken till today. Construction of the sanitary complex near the obstetrics and gynaecology ward is dragging even after six months. We sent memorandum for removal of 260-bed ward and the dialysis unit buildings, which are fragile. The roof of the rooms beneath the toilets are leaking for several months. Trees are growing on the TKMCH buildings. None of these appeals from TKMCH has been heard and translated into action,” the doctors complain.
They also said the officials concerned should ensure the quality of the lifts being installed for easy transfer of patients from wards to the operation theatres and vice-versa. And, superior quality should be ensured in the renovation of the auditorium, which is being done with ₹1 crore funding under Corporate Social Responsibility fund from a thermal power generation unit.
